Major General Ali Abdullah bin Olwan Al Nuaimi Commander-in-chief of Ras Al Khaimah police, in the presence of a number of police officers, honored 1st Sgt. Samir Abdullah Habbabi,RAK traffic policeman, for his positive initiative to create and implement the campaign "buckle-up and smile". The campaign aims to raise public awareness of the importance of wearing seatbelts.
Al Habbabi urgedmotorists and passengers to buckle upas he was standing on the roadwith a big smile on his face, leaving a positive impact among them.His attitude perfectly fits with the ministry of interior's strategy which calls for maintaining proper behavior.
RAK Police Commander-in-chief said that this honoring is in response to the public's requests through social media. He confirmed that RAK Police is ready to support and motivate creative people coming up with inspiring initiatives that serve policing and security work. He praised him for his role in promoting communication and strengthening relationship between Ras Al Khaimah policeand the community.
For his part, Sergeant Sameer Abdullah Al Hababi thanked the Police Commander for the nice gesture and also thanked all the police staffat RAK Police for their cooperation and efforts, stressing that he will spare no efforts to serve the interests of the UAE.
